New Delhi: Shri Sandeep Kumar Gupta, Chairman and Managing Dircetor of GAIL took a review of the ongoing Natural Gas pipeline project from Krishnagiri to Coimbatore in Tamil Nadu on June 5th and 6th, 2024. He was accompanied by the Shri Deepak Gupta, Director (Projects), Shri A K Tripathi, ED (Projects), and other senior GAIL officials.
